Frequently asked questions

About High Tech LA Middle
How large is High Tech LA Middle?
High Tech LA Middle enrolls approximately 235 students in grades 06-08.
What grades does High Tech LA Middle serve?
High Tech LA Middle serves grades 06-08.
How many teachers does High Tech LA Middle have?
High Tech LA Middle employs 10 FTE teachers, for a student-to-teacher ratio of 23.1:1.
What is the student diversity at High Tech LA Middle?
Student demographics at High Tech LA Middle are roughly 73% White, 20% Hispanic, 1% Black, 2% Asian, 4% Two or more.
What district is High Tech LA Middle in?
High Tech LA Middle is part of High Tech LA Middle District.
